Output e0684526b4d60f550da5233159c1f033786eb164a46a3ac1644a0cb794c4ed73:1

value
1000726
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dc593421ec9f15d8e646b45f147c07af7f78967e OP_EQUALVERIFY OP_CHECKSIG
address
1M66XBU1DWp9kcf2h6MWC1hCn2bAY4pAw8
transaction
e0684526b4d60f550da5233159c1f033786eb164a46a3ac1644a0cb794c4ed73
spent
true